         So I’m low on wood pellets, and won’t have time to run across town to Tractor Supply to get more before I run out.  I called around a few places, and Menard’s has wood stove pellets for under $4 for a 40lb bag.  I asked the guy if they had any chemicals in them and he said no, it’s 100% compressed wood.  Anyone have experience with the wood stove pellets from Menard’s?  Here’s a link to them:

         

        http://menards.com/main/plumbing/heating-cooling/fuel/40-lb-premium-wood-pellets/p-1463989-c-8463.htm

         

        I always have used the horse stall bedding kind of pellets in the past, but these are cheaper and closer.  Menard’s is only like 5 mins from my house, Tractor Supply is at least 15-20 mins. 


      • bunnyfriend
        Participant
        2368 posts Send Private Message

          I would double check the back and read what’s in them when you buy them just to be safe, and that should be fine.


        • Michelle&Lolli
          Participant
          2347 posts Send Private Message

            If you do a search under the diet and care section, there’s a few posts about them. From what I understand, any type should be fine as long as there is no acceleration added.
